Fairway Bend is a small gated subdivision within Broken Sound in Boca Raton, offering a residential setting inside one of the area’s established private country club communities. With 21 homes, Fairway Bend has a more intimate scale than many of the other villages within Broken Sound.
Residents of Fairway Bend are also part of the broader Broken Sound community, with access to its extensive club amenities and landscaped surroundings. The subdivision is conveniently positioned near Yamato Road and St. Andrews Boulevard, with central Boca Raton shopping, dining, recreation, and major roadways nearby.
About Fairway Bend
Fairway Bend is a single-family home subdivision within Broken Sound. The community is gated and consists of 21 residences, making it one of the smaller residential villages within the larger Broken Sound development.
The homes are arranged along residential streets within the larger Broken Sound setting. While Fairway Bend has its own neighborhood identity, many of the lifestyle features associated with the address come from Broken Sound itself rather than from Fairway Bend as a separate subdivision.
History of Fairway Bend
Fairway Bend was developed as one of the residential villages within Broken Sound, a Boca Raton country club community that took shape during the late 1980s and early 1990s. Over the years, Broken Sound has continued to evolve through clubhouse, wellness, dining, golf, and racquet improvements while its individual villages have retained their distinct residential character.
Fairway Bend remains a small component of the larger Broken Sound community, with its 21-home footprint distinguishing it from some of the development’s larger villages.
Amenities
Fairway Bend’s amenities should be distinguished from those of the larger Broken Sound community.
Fairway Bend: The subdivision is gated and provides a residential setting within Broken Sound.
Broken Sound: Club amenities include two golf courses, tennis and pickleball facilities, fitness and wellness facilities, swimming pools, dining, and social spaces.
Nearby Boca Raton: Residents are close to the broader selection of shopping, restaurants, parks, recreation, and entertainment available throughout Boca Raton.
Access to Broken Sound’s club facilities is tied to club membership, and current membership requirements and categories should be confirmed when purchasing a home.

Nearby Communities
Fairway Lake: Another residential subdivision within Broken Sound, Fairway Lake is located nearby and has 37 homes. Like Fairway Bend, it combines individual village character with access to the larger Broken Sound setting.
Fairway Landing: Also within Broken Sound, Fairway Landing contains 48 homes and offers another single-family residential option within the same gated country club community.
Cloisters: Cloisters is another Broken Sound village with its own residential character, providing an additional nearby option for comparing homes within the larger community.
